How to Reach Lambsheim, Germany

If you're planning a trip to Germany, make sure to include the charming town of Lambsheim in your itinerary. Located in the Rhineland-Palatinate region, Lambsheim offers a perfect blend of natural beauty, historical landmarks, and warm hospitality. Here's how you can reach Lambsheim:

By Air

The nearest international airport to Lambsheim is Frankfurt Airport, which is approximately 85 kilometers away. From the airport, you can hire a taxi or rent a car to reach Lambsheim. Alternatively, you can take a train from Frankfurt Airport to Ludwigshafen am Rhein and then transfer to a local train or bus to Lambsheim.

By Train

Lambsheim has its own train station, making it easily accessible by rail. If you're coming from other parts of Germany or neighboring countries, you can take a train to Ludwigshafen Hauptbahnhof (main station) and then catch a connecting train to Lambsheim. The journey from Ludwigshafen to Lambsheim takes around 15 minutes.

By Car

If you prefer driving, Lambsheim is conveniently located close to major highways. From Frankfurt, you can take the A5 and A6 highways, which will lead you directly to Lambsheim. The journey takes approximately 1 hour, depending on traffic conditions. Lambsheim also has ample parking facilities available for visitors.

By Bus

Lambsheim is well-connected to neighboring towns and cities through a reliable bus network. You can check the regional bus schedules and routes to find the most convenient option for reaching Lambsheim. Buses are a cost-effective and eco-friendly mode of transportation, allowing you to enjoy the scenic views along the way.

By Bicycle

If you're an avid cyclist or enjoy exploring the countryside at a leisurely pace, Lambsheim is easily accessible by bicycle. The town is surrounded by picturesque landscapes and offers well-maintained cycling paths. You can rent a bicycle from nearby towns or bring your own to enjoy a scenic ride to Lambsheim.

Getting to know Lambsheim, Germany

Lambsheim is a small municipality located in the Rhineland-Palatinate state of Germany. It is situated in the district of Bad Dürkheim and has a population of approximately 4,500 people. The town is known for its picturesque countryside, historical landmarks, and vibrant cultural scene.

One of the most notable landmarks in Lambsheim is the Protestant Church of Lambsheim, which dates back to the 12th century. The church has undergone several renovations over the years, but still retains its original Romanesque style architecture.

Lambsheim is also home to the Lambsheim Castle, a majestic edifice built in the Renaissance style. While the castle is privately owned and not open to the public, visitors can still enjoy the panoramic views of the surrounding landscape from its grounds.

The town boasts a rich cultural heritage and is host to several festivals throughout the year, including the Lambsheim Wine Village Festival, which celebrates the local wine culture. Visitors can sample the delicious wines of the region and enjoy live music and entertainment.
